Benefits of Students Learning Coding from Class 6 - Pros & Cons

Benefits of Students Learning Coding from Class 6 - Pros & Cons

  • Home
  • Blog
  • India
  • Benefits of Students Learning Coding from Class 6 - Pros & Cons
Benefits of Students Learning Coding from Class 6 - Pros & Cons
Sailesh Sitaula

Coding is writing instructions in a programming language that a computer can understand and execute. It involves creating software, websites, apps, and other digital solutions for real-world problems. The ability to code has become an essential skill in today's digital age, and it is increasingly being integrated into various fields and industries.

In recent years, there has been a growing emphasis on the importance of coding education, particularly for students. As technology continues to evolve, learning to code has become a critical skill for success in the workforce. The ability to code opens up opportunities in software development, web design, data analysis, cybersecurity, and many more. 

Moreover, coding also promotes valuable skills such as logical thinking, problem-solving, and creativity, which are useful in various professions. Therefore, providing coding education to students is an investment in their future, equipping them with the necessary skills and knowledge to succeed in the digital world.

Benefits of learning coding in Class 6

Promotes logical thinking:

Coding involves categorising complex problems into smaller, more manageable parts and organising them logically. This process helps students develop their logical thinking skills, which can be applied in various aspects of their lives, such as decision-making and problem-solving. By learning coding in Class 6, students can develop these skills early and apply them to their academic and personal lives.

Improves problem-solving skills:

Coding requires students to identify and solve problems logically and systematically. By learning to code, students develop problem-solving skills, which can help them tackle complex problems and find innovative solutions. These skills are useful not only in computer science but also in various fields and industries.

Enhances creativity:

Coding involves creating something from scratch and requires students to think outside the box to solve problems. By learning to code, students can develop their creativity and imagination as they learn to create new things and innovate in various fields. Moreover, coding can also be used to create interactive art, music, and games, providing students a platform to express their creativity.

Boosts career opportunities:

As technology continues to play an increasingly significant role in our lives, the demand for skilled coders is also growing. By learning to code in Class 6, students can set themselves up for future success and open up numerous career opportunities in software development, web design, data analysis, and cybersecurity. Moreover, coding skills can also be valuable in other professions like finance, healthcare, and education.

Pros and Cons

Pros of learning coding in Class 6

Early exposure to coding:

By introducing coding education early, students can develop an interest in computer science and technology. Early exposure to coding can ignite a passion for learning and problem-solving, encouraging students to pursue further education and career opportunities in these fields. Additionally, early exposure to coding can help students build a strong foundation of knowledge and skills, setting them up for success in their future studies.

Better retention of skills:

Research has shown that learning new skills at a young age can lead to better retention of knowledge and skills over time. By learning to code in Class 6, students can be exposed to new concepts and techniques when their brains are still developing, making it easier for them to retain this information and build upon it in the future.

Better retention of skills:

Computational thinking is a problem-solving technique that involves breaking down complex problems into smaller, more manageable parts. Learning to code in Class 6 can help students develop their computational thinking skills, enabling them to approach problems in a more organised and structured way. This skill can be applied to many problems, not just computer science-related.

Develops a growth mindset:

Coding is a skill that requires persistence and a growth mindset. Students who learn to code in Class 6 can develop a mindset that values the process of learning and growth rather than just the outcome. This mindset can help them tackle challenges and overcome obstacles in computer science and all areas of their lives.

Fosters innovation:

Coding involves creating new and innovative solutions to problems. By learning to code in Class 6, students can develop their creativity and innovation skills as they learn to think outside the box and create something new. This skill can be applied to various fields and industries, making it valuable for future success.

Cons of learning coding in Class 6

Curriculum overload:

Introducing coding education in Class 6 is an additional subject that students must learn, leading to an already crowded curriculum. Schools may find it challenging to incorporate coding education into their curriculum without sacrificing other essential subjects. Additionally, some students may find it difficult to balance the workload of learning coding and other academic subjects.

Misconceptions about coding:

Coding is often portrayed as a complex and difficult subject that only a select few can master. Students with misconceptions about coding may feel discouraged from pursuing further education and career opportunities in computer science. Schools may need to invest in providing support and resources to ensure that students receive the necessary guidance and encouragement to develop their coding skills.

Burnout:

Learning to code can be challenging, and students may experience burnout if they do not receive the necessary support and encouragement. Ensuring students can handle the workload and have a supportive learning environment is essential. Teachers may need to incorporate breaks and activities that allow students to take a break from coding and engage in other activities to reduce the risk of burnout.

Conclusion

In conclusion, learning to code in Class 6 can benefit students, including promoting logical thinking, improving problem-solving skills, enhancing creativity, and boosting career opportunities.

The pros of learning coding at a young age include early exposure to coding, better retention of skills, improved computational thinking, development of a growth mindset, and fostering innovation. However, there are also some cons to learning coding in Class 6, including curriculum overload, misconceptions about coding, and the risk of burnout.

Given the benefits of coding education, educators and parents must support and encourage students to learn to code early. Schools should incorporate coding education into their curriculum, provide the necessary resources and support, and dispel misconceptions about coding. Parents can also play a vital role in encouraging their children to learn to code by providing access to online resources and opportunities to practice coding at home.

The future of coding education looks promising as more and more schools incorporate coding into their curriculum. The demand for computer science and technology-related jobs is increasing, and learning to code can provide students with a competitive advantage in the job market. As technology advances, coding will become even more important, and students who learn to code in Class 6 will be well-prepared to adapt to these changes.

Related Posts :

blog

BSC Nursing in India

BSc Nursing in India: Eligibility Criteria, entrance test, government colleges, Private Colleges, and Cost of Studying. BSC Nursing jobs in India.
Rojina RautTue Apr 25 2023
blog

Bachelor in Business Administration (BBA) in India

Complete guide to Bachelor in Business Administration (BBA) In India, like TOP BBA Colleges, BBA entrance Exams and other highlights of BBA in India.
Meena TamangTue Apr 25 2023